Ordinals
beta
Sat 683816550097322
decimal
136763.1550097322
degree
0°136763′1691″1550097322‴
percentile
32.56269289759622%
name
izuoumhkqmx
cycle
0
epoch
0
period
67
block
136763
offset
1550097322
timestamp
2011-07-17 18:12:42 UTC
rarity
common
prev
next